Many of the 1913 engine companies were organized on March 20th but their ladder companies did not come on until the fall of 1913. A few neighboring engine companies were Combination Companies (engine, hosewagon & city service ladder) that were disbanded and reorganized as single engines when or shortly after those ladder companies went into service. For example: Combination Engines 240, 242, 247, 248 and 250 were disbanded when L147, L148 and L149 were organized on May 15, 1914.

1913 was an FDNY expansion year.  Looks like the following companies were organized as the department expanded with city growth:

Engines 91,92,93,94,159,281,282,283,284,285,286,287,288,289
Ladders 42,43,44,45,46,47,48,49,131,132,134,135,136,137

Might have missed a unit but congratulations to companies serving 100 years.
